pip - 如何将 mpi4py 链接到 intelmpi

标签 pip openmpi mpi4py intel-mpi

我想针对 intelmpi 安装 mpi4py,这正是我在做模块列表时看到的。

但是 mpi4py.get_config() 在这些试验后显示 openmpi:

pip install mpi4py
env MPICC=/share/apps/intel/2017u4/impi/2017.3.196/intel64/bin/mpicc pip install mpi4py

我没有删除 openmpi 的权限。我如何清除它以便 mpi4py 得到正确的?

最佳答案

Installation instructionsmpicc 应该在 $PATH 所以试试

env PATH=/share/apps/intel/2017u4/impi/2017.3.196/intel64/bin:$PATH pip install mpi4py

关于pip - 如何将 mpi4py 链接到 intelmpi,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52012871/

相关文章:

python - 可以例如pip 列出 extras_require 的选项?

python - 安装 OpenCV 失败,因为它找不到 "skbuild"

python - 调试并行 Python 程序 (mpi4py)

python-3.x - 使用 SLURM 和 MPI(4PY) : Cannot allocate requested resources

python-3.x - Python 3 virtualenv 和 Docker

Eclipse PTP : Running parallel (MPI) applications on the local machine?

c - MPI 广播字符串数组

C、Open MPI : segmentation fault from call to MPI_Finalize(). 段错误并不总是发生,尤其是在进程数量较少的情况下

python-2.7 - mpi4py - MPI_ERR_TRUNCATE : message truncated

python - PyPI 和 pip - 安装的包在读取 README.md 时收到错误